Matt Mulloy scored 11 points for Kingwood in a 43-37 loss to College Park in the Region II-5A bi-district playoffs at Porter High School on Tuesday. College Park used a stifling defense in the fourth quarter to pull away from the Mustangs and advance in the postseason. The Cavaliers (31-5) move on to play Westwood in the area playoffs with the time and place to be determined. College Park was able to hold off a pesky Kingwood in the first round of the playoffs as the two teams exchanged blows until the final whistle. click here for complete story and additional photos.
